Patents by Inventor David Gang

David Gang has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20080021288
    Abstract: The invention features methods, systems, and computer programs for generating a customized set of possible medical conditions, thereby providing access to medical information relevant to the user's state of health. The methods and systems involve at least some of the following steps: receiving a list of symptoms specified in terms selected from a first language set; translating the list of symptoms into a translated list of symptoms specified in terms selected from a second language set; using the translated list of symptoms to generate possible medical conditions, the possible medical conditions described in terms of the second language set; and translating the possible medical conditions into descriptions that are specified in terms selected from the first language set.
    Type: Application
    Filed: July 24, 2006
    Publication date: January 24, 2008
    Inventors: Brad Bowman, Tushar Tanna, David Link, David Gang
  • Publication number: 20060224604
    Abstract: The present invention provides for navigation systems for table data structures, and methods for facilitating the locating of information in a table data structure. To generate the navigation system, a sort criteria being used to organize the table data structure is identified. After identifying page delineations in the table data structure, data ranges of each page are identified based on the sort criteria corresponding to each page. The data ranges corresponding to each page are displayed on a graphical user interface to indicate to the user the content of each page.
    Type: Application
    Filed: October 27, 2005
    Publication date: October 5, 2006
    Inventors: Richard Landsman, David Gang
  • Publication number: 20060167991
    Abstract: Customizing instant messaging communications for a first instant messaging participant includes receiving first filter criteria corresponding to an online presence state of instant messaging participants to be filtered. First information associated with each of one or more other instant messaging participants selected by the first instant messaging participant is accessed. The first filter criteria is applied to the first information for each of the other instant messaging participants to obtain a first filter result for each of the other instant messaging participants. A participant list is configured to persistently reflect a display of information about the other instant messaging participants according to the first filter result for each of the other instant messaging participants.
    Type: Application
    Filed: December 16, 2004
    Publication date: July 27, 2006
    Inventors: Brian Heikes, David Gang
  • Publication number: 20060123346
    Abstract: A multipurpose text application which provides a user interface which provides a plurality of delivery mechanisms or actions for handling a text document prepared using the user interface. Actions can include text messaging, instant messaging, emailing, creating contact entries, creating calendar entries, creating journal entries, creating note or memos, creating tasks, and storing a draft of the text document. The user can select one or more actions before, during or after the text document is created. In addition, the network status of one or more intended recipients can be monitored to assist the user in selecting the action.
    Type: Application
    Filed: December 6, 2004
    Publication date: June 8, 2006
    Inventors: Scott Totman, Kerry Pearce, Patrick Schwermer, David Gang, Marlon Bishop, Joe Hewitt
  • Publication number: 20050055450
    Abstract: A “buddy member match” feature is directed to matching computer users of like interests, particularly computer users who are members of an online service provider. In general, a member (the match recipient) may update or create a member profile maintained by a service provider such as AOL. Once the match recipient has a member profile, a search is initiated to identify matching members by comparing the member profile of the match recipient to the member profiles of other members. Matching members are other members whose member profiles have at least one personal attribute matching an attribute of the match recipient's member profile. When contact information of the matching member is displayed, the contact information is accompanied by an indication that the contact information belongs to a matching member.
    Type: Application
    Filed: November 10, 2003
    Publication date: March 10, 2005
    Inventor: David Gang
  • Publication number: 20040172455
    Abstract: A graphical user interface between a user of a computer service and the computer service includes a list of other users of the computer service selected by the user as significant to the user and an icon associated with one of the other listed users indicating that a communication has occurred between the user and the other user.
    Type: Application
    Filed: November 18, 2003
    Publication date: September 2, 2004
    Inventors: Mitchell Chapin Green, Roger Chickering, David Gang
  • Publication number: 20040172456
    Abstract: A graphical user interface between a client system used by a user to access a computer service and a host system of the computer service includes a list of other users of the computer service selected by the user as significant to the user, a list of computer resources stored on the host system by the user, and a list of links to data content, that have been selected by the user.
    Type: Application
    Filed: November 18, 2003
    Publication date: September 2, 2004
    Inventors: Mitchell Chapin Green, Roger Chickering, David Gang
  • Publication number: 20040153517
    Abstract: Automatically saving communicated multimedia objects to a repository for subsequent use includes in response to a sent electronic message and a received electronic message, identifying an embedded multimedia object or an attached multimedia object. The embedded multimedia object or the attached multimedia object is separated from the electronic message. The separated multimedia object is automatically saved to a repository for subsequent use by a user and the user is able to select the multimedia object from the repository for subsequent use.
    Type: Application
    Filed: November 18, 2003
    Publication date: August 5, 2004
    Inventors: David Gang, Barry Appelman